Chinese premier arrives in Islamabad tomorrow

ISLAMABAD: Li Keqiang will be accorded a rousing welcome on his arrival on a two-day official visit of Pakistan

It is the first visit of Chinese premier Li Keqiang to Pakistan after becoming the prime minister of China which will provide an opportunity to him to meet new Pakistani leadership and discuss ways to further strengthen deep rooted bilateral ties.

This visit will give further impetus to strategic relations between the two countries.

During his stay in Islamabad‚ the Chines Prime Minister will hold in-depth talks with President Asif Ali Zardari‚ Prime Minister Mir Hazar Khan Khoso‚ PML-N chief Mian Nawaz Sharif and other elected political leaders.

It is expected that both the countries will sign several agreements and Memorandum of Understandings to further enhance bilateral cooperation in the fields of economy‚ energy‚ culture and education.

Pakistani leadership will also seek more cooperation from China in the field of power and energy given the present dire power situation.

President Asif Ali Zardari will host a luncheon in honor of the Chinese premier. It will also be attended by the newly elected political leadership.

The Chinese Prime Minister will also address the Senate on Thursday.

Islamabad Traffic Police has chalked out a special traffic plan during the visit of the Chines Premier for smooth running of traffic
